Transaction 515bcab1640a25d410d2edf6cec50cdc4b449715927257ef04d0f2ac439680f7
1 Input
2 Outputs
- 515bcab1640a25d410d2edf6cec50cdc4b449715927257ef04d0f2ac439680f7:0
- 515bcab1640a25d410d2edf6cec50cdc4b449715927257ef04d0f2ac439680f7:1
value 26510249
address 1EiFmb4aJCvFceqxxWBr8jVcxagcygAwkx
value 39319942
address 12cSYokxBHHEd1ZDrF2Tamp52h69posucF